State Strategies to Improve Maternal Health and Promote Health Equity Compendium

Patricia Boozang, Linda Elam, Kaylee O’Connor, and Michelle Savuto, Manatt Health

Given the outsized role of Medicaid in maternal health—accounting for 75% of all public expenditures for family planning services and covering close to half of all births nationally—state policymakers have both a moral imperative and major opportunity to improve and protect the health and well-being of their pregnant/postpartum residents, their infants and families. This compendium provides information on strategies to improve maternal health outcomes and synthesizes research about the national state-of-play, including state examples, across four domains: maternal health models, quality improvement, workforce and benefits, and eligibility and enrollment/coverage expansion. This resource builds on a September 2022 maternal health roundtable convened by State Health and Value Strategies (SHVS) and Manatt Health with California, Louisiana, Maryland, Minnesota, and Tennessee.
